Is this the last of the affordable 1960s Ferraris?


Is the time to buy a 1960s Ferrari GT at auction definitely over for the non-millionaires among us? Perhaps not. If you are not too picky, you may be able to buy this 330 GT 2+2 for a price that may be considered outright cheap compared to just about all of its sister models from around the same time. It’s a 1966 second-series example, chassis number 8319 for the aficionados among you, that was originally built as a European-specification example with power windows and a five-speed manual transmission and finished in Bianco (white) and Rosso (red) interior. Having said that, the first of the car’s flaws is uncovered: it does not wear its original paint colour anymore. Instead, it wears a gorgeous metallic blue that may well suit it even better.

But there are more imperfections. Take a deep breath. It had accident damage in the not so far past. The transmission tunnel and dashboard have been modified to non-standard specification. And just about all of the early history is missing. It was sold in Spain, that’s all we know. Oh – when you look a bit closer you will notice a skew rear bumper and badges that may need some work. Well, it’s all not too difficult to overcome, isn’t it? Just look at the positive side. It’s got its matching numbers, which cannot even be said for some of the million dollar models. The interior looks lovingly refurbished in its original red. Being the series 2-model, it comes with the pretty single headlights, cool side vents and lovely 10 holes wheels. And, hey, it wears Monaco plates!

So in the light of the day, the £170- to £190,000 estimate may well be a very good price. It’s offered by RM Sothebys in London next weekend, see the full description here. There’s a slightly later (1968) GTC-version in the same sale with better provenance and no flaws, but you have to fork out almost three times as much for that…
